Handover: Flagwright rollout framework, from Dario to Mei. The percentage-based cohort splitter shipped Tuesday; watch the Kestrel service, which still reads stale flag snapshots for up to 90 seconds after a toggle. If the control plane locks you out during an incident, use the break-glass account in the Flagwright admin vault. The recovery passphrase for that account is below.

recovery phrase for baweg-faweg: zorael-framir

// REINDEX_BATCH_CAP limits docs per shard pass in the Tallowfield
// nightly search reindex. Raising it starves the ingest queue;
// lowering it overruns the maintenance window. 5000 is the tested
// sweet spot. Change only with a soak run. Verified against the
// build noted below.

session token of bawif-hahog = htk6_ac5981

Seat-map renderer for the Garnet Hall theatre client is ready to ship. Zoom/pan verified on low-end tablets. Accessible row labels pass the Lintworth audit. Obstructed-view overlays now load from the Vexley pricing service instead of the static JSON, so confirm the feature flag is on in prod. Known gap: balcony curvature is approximate; fix slated for next cycle. QA signed off Tuesday. Reference build for rollback purposes is pinned under the token below.

pipeline stamp: htk14_378fd70323001d

INTERNAL MEMO — Stellenreed Industries

To: Heads of Department
Re: Revised sales-commission scheme

From next quarter, commission on the Arbordale product line moves from flat 4% to a tiered structure rewarding multi-year renewals and margin quality rather than headline volume. Accelerators apply above 110% of target; clawbacks apply to cancellations within six months. Please brief your teams carefully and consistently before the cutover date. The strategic context for this change is set out in the confidential note below.

confidential, kagep-kahof: Druokax Systems plans to lower the Ulaath list price by 53 percent in March.